> >Hi James,
> >Yes he did, in fact an article I have about him and a couple of his
> >children
> >is that he apparently decided to make counterfiet money and when he was
> >caught and taken to court his sons Jonathan (this is the line we fall
> >under)
> >and James both agreed to join the revolutionary army and Samuel was sent
to
> >the Augusta County Jail. See the thing about it is that where he bought
> >and
> >sold several acres of land was all in the same area where the line of
> >Ingram's that you are working all lived. Very confusing!

> > > >Hi James,
> > > >Thanks for the information. At one time as I was going through all
the
> > > >information that I have found on the internet I thought that we fell
> >under
> > > >John Ingram and Hannah Pines. They have a son names Samuel only
> >problem
> > > >with this is the Samuel they have listed died in 1771 and we know for
a
> > > >fact that our Samuel died in 1799 and his will was proven in 1801 I
> >believe
> > > >(I don't have the papers right here in front of me so can not be
exact
> >on
> > > >the date it was proven) but I do know that he did in 1799. We also
> >know
> > > >that he married a woman by the name of Anne but there does seem to be
> >some
> > > >speculations as to weather her last name was Stewart or Menefee. So
> >far
> >I
> > > >have not come acrossed a researcher yet that has been able to give
any
> >more
> > > >definate proof of who his father and mother were. There was also
some
> > > >speculation as to Samuel Ingram that they have listed as John and
> >Hannah's
> > > >son. Some say that he was John's son from a first marriage as he is
> > > >mentioned in John's will but his will makes it sound more as Samuel
was
> >his
> > > >eldest son. Who knows but I will keep digging up what I can and
> >compareing
> > > >notes of all researchers maybe I will find something one of these
days.
> > > >Thanks for all your information.
> > > >Barbara

> > > > Hi Barbara! Good to hear from you. Always enjoy hearing from
cousins
> >out
> > > > there. Yep! There are several John Ingram's out there. Finding the
> >one
> > > >you
> > > > belong to is the challenge. My line goes like this. Robert Ingram
> >and
> > > > Unknown, John Ingram Sr. and Frances Collier, John Ingram Jr. and
> >Jane
> > > > Unknown, Thomas Ingram and Kathrine Winter, John Ingram Sr. and
Ann
> > > >Sisson,
> > > > John Ingram Jr. and Patience Berry, Sarah Ingram and Christopher
> > > >Dameron,
> > > > Nancy Ann Morehead Dameron and Vines Matthews/Matthis, Thomas
> >Matthis
> > > >and
> > > > Elizabeth Betsy Childs, Vines L. Matthis and Mary Jane Miller,
> >Virginia
> > > >Jane
> > > > Matthis and Wiseman Tracy Tims, Wiseman Monroe Tims and Lillie
> >Kathyrn
> > > > Parrott, Andrew Jackson Tims and Daisy Mitchell, Talmadge Judson
> >Tims
> > > >and
> > > > Hazel Marie Smith, and they are my parents. Got a good deal of
